Once Upon a Time...
Once upon a time, in a quiet little village, nestled under a blanket of soft, glistening snow, there were three young friends named Lily, Ben, and Mia. The air was filled with the gentle sound of jingling bells, and the sky twinkled with the glow of countless stars.
The children loved Christmas time. They loved the way the snowflakes danced like tiny, sparkling fairies, settling gently on their mittens. And most of all, they loved to help choose a special decoration for the village Christmas tree.
Every year, the village held a special ceremony. The children would gather around the tall, grand tree, decorated with shiny baubles and twinkling lights. This year, it was Lily, Ben, and Mia's turn to choose the very best decoration.
The Snowy Adventure
On a bright, frosty morning, Lily, Ben, and Mia set off on their adventure. The snow beneath their boots crunched softly like sugar. "Let's find the prettiest decoration ever!" said Lily with a giggle.
They walked to Mr. Tinker's shop, where every shelf was lined with decorations that shimmered like stars. "Look at this one!" Ben pointed to a silver star that glowed like the moon. "Oh, and this angel is so lovely!" Mia twirled, holding a delicate angel that seemed to smile kindly at them.
But Lily, Ben, and Mia weren't quite sure what to choose. They felt a little bit like the lost snowflakes that sometimes drift too far. "Let's ask Mr. Tinker," said Lily, her eyes bright as the winter sky.
"Choosing takes time, little ones," said Mr. Tinker, his voice as warm as a cup of cocoa. "You need to listen to your hearts, for they always know the way."
A Magical Choice
The children sat on the soft, snowy bench outside the shop, watching the world wrapped in a sparkling white blanket. "I think Mr. Tinker is right," said Mia. "We should be patient."
The friends talked and laughed, their voices ringing like tiny bells in the crisp air. As they shared stories, a gentle hush fell over them, like the blanket of snow on a sleepy hill.
Then, as if by magic, Lily noticed a small, plain box beneath the bench. Inside was a simple, wooden heart, smooth and polished. It was not shiny or bright, but it felt warm and kind.
"This is it," whispered Lily, her eyes wide with wonder. Ben and Mia nodded, understanding that the heart was special. It was a symbol of the love and friendship they shared, shining brighter than any star.
The Christmas Spirit
When the children placed the wooden heart on the grand tree, everyone gathered 'round, smiling with the gentle warmth of a flickering candle. The heart seemed to glow from within, casting a soft, peaceful light over the village.
As the snowflakes continued their dance, Lily, Ben, and Mia felt a sense of joy and wonder. They knew that the heart was the perfect decoration, a reminder that the true spirit of Christmas was all around them.
The village tree sparkled with the beauty of kindness and friendship, and the air was filled with the sweet sound of laughter and joy.
And so, the children learned that sometimes, patience and love can create the most magical Christmas of all.
The world outside was quiet, and the gentle glow of the moon wrapped everything in its soft embrace. And with hearts full of warmth and joy, everyone knew that this Christmas would live on forever in their dreams.
And that, dear friends, is how the magic of Christmas lights up the hearts of all who believe.
